32-39-2.
Warranties--Schedule--Compensation.
The schedule of compensation for warranty
work governed by § 32-39-1 shall include reasonable compensation for diagnostic work, as well as
repair service, parts, labor, and transportation of equipment for warranty repairs. Reimbursement for
transportation of equipment to the dealership for needed warranty repairs and the return of the
equipment is at the dealership's retail rate if the customer is within the dealer's designated area of
responsibility. Time allowances for diagnosis and performance of warranty work and service shall
be adequate for the work to be performed. The hourly labor rate paid the dealer for warranty services
may not be less than the rate charged by the dealer for like services to nonwarranty customers for
nonwarranty service. Reimbursement for parts used in the performance of warranty repair may not
be less than the amount paid by the dealer to acquire the parts plus a reasonable allowance for
handling, which may not be less than thirty percent.
Source: SL 1998, ch 173, § 2.
